Output 953cc77d17881243f78a5f5ffe23e492844f3aad85ab5b1670091d1c9a96b822:0

value
667476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c22beb4dee7d6769ba3a12e41ac5045d25ae44d0 OP_EQUAL
address
3KPhdKFQMhh4k1Uo5vJniFWYbAQfA9MjH8
transaction
953cc77d17881243f78a5f5ffe23e492844f3aad85ab5b1670091d1c9a96b822
spent
true